11 water piping hotter water can scald: water heaters are intended to produce hot water. Water heated to a temperature which will satisfy space heating, clothes washing, dish washing, cleaning and other sanitizing needs can scald and permanently injure you upon contact. 13 the temperature-pressure relief valve must be manually operated at least once a year. 17 maximum and minimum vent lengths 40,000 btu units: for 2" venting, the maximum equivalent feet of pipe allowed is 40 feet (12.2 m). 23 for your information start up conditions condensate whenever the water heater is fi lled with cold water, some condensate will form while the burner is on. 24 venting system inspection at least once a year a visual inspection should be made of the venting system. You should look for: 1. Obstructions which could cause improper venting.
